WebOct 1, 2011 · Assuming a baseline risk of 6%, we estimate the lifetime risks for carriers of CHEK2 truncating mutations to be 20% for a woman with no affected relative, 28% for a woman with one second-degree relative affected, 34% for a woman with one first-degree relative affected, and 44% for a woman with both a first- and second-degree relative … WebMar 14, 2024 · Because of the increased risk for a second breast cancer diagnosis, women who are diagnosed with breast cancer who test positive for an inherited mutation in … tacos in murfreesboro
